BlockBeats News, July 15th - Indian AI programming startup Emergent has completed a $130 million Series C funding round, reaching a post-money valuation of $1.5 billion, a significant increase from the $300 million valuation during its Series B funding in January this year. The round was led by Creaegis, with participation from Khosla Ventures, SoftBank Vision Fund 2, Lightspeed, Y Combinator, among others, bringing the total funding raised by the company to $230 million.
Emergent primarily targets entrepreneurs and small to medium-sized enterprises, offering an integrated AI development platform covering programming, deployment, hosting, testing, and debugging. The company has stated that its annual recurring revenue has reached $120 million, with over 200,000 paying customers. This funding will be used mainly to advance product development, enhance AI agent workflow capabilities, and expand market outreach, including considering establishing an office in Europe.
